Transaction

b7bd691dc6c287ef099f1ff1bed3aed7a8d83d95122a753c07ef39ca1b9d80f2

Summary

In Block626095
TimeMon, 25 Mar 2024 00:23:30 UTC
Total Input603.87286946 Nebula
Total Output637.87286946 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
344656 Confirmations637.87286946 Nebula
Raw Transaction